IPQ5018 | Wallys DR5018S VLAN Configuration Guide

1. Introduction


The Wallys DR5018S, powered by the Qualcomm IPQ5018 chipset, is widely adopted in industrial wireless networking environments.

In complex networks, VLANs (Virtual LANs) are essential for traffic isolation, refined management, and enhanced security.


This guide provides a step-by-step tutorial to configure Access VLANs and Trunk VLANs on the DR5018S.


2. VLAN Basics


Before diving into configuration, it’s important to understand a few key concepts:

▶ VLAN (Virtual LAN)

Logically segments a network to reduce broadcast domains and improve manageability.

▶ Access VLAN

Used for end devices such as PCs. Each port belongs to a single VLAN, and frames are transmitted without VLAN tags.

▶ Trunk VLAN

Used for interconnecting devices such as switches or APs. A single port can carry multiple VLANs, and frames are tagged accordingly.


✅ In short: Access mode is for end-user devices, while Trunk mode is for device-to-device connections.


3. Prerequisites


Before configuration, ensure the following:

▶ A Wallys DR5018S router (running Wallys firmware)

▶ Admin access via Web GUI or SSH

▶ A planned VLAN ID scheme and IP addressing plan

▶ (Optional) A VLAN-capable NIC or managed switch for testing



4. VLAN Configuration on DR5018S

Steps:

1.Log in to the Web GUI.

2.Go to System → Services. Left the Enable NSS uncheck and click “save and apply”

3.Go to Network → Vlans.Create a VLAN (e.g., VLAN 2000).

4.Edit the ath1(the working radio) and eth0(the ethernet port connected) port mode to Trunk.

5.ath1 setting:Select type Trunk,Assign the PVID as 1,select Vlans 2000,save changes

6.ath1 setting:Select type Trunk,Assign the PVID as 1,select Vlans 2000,save changes.

7.Assign an IP address to the VLAN interface (static or DHCP).

8.Save and apply the configuration.

9.Test connectivity: connect a PC to the port, get an IP, and ping the radio.

5. Troubleshooting


▶ Unable to access the device → Verify VLAN ID, PVID, and tagging configuration

▶ Trunk traffic loss → Check that the remote device (switch or AP) has matching VLAN settings

▶ PC cannot ping → Ensure the assigned IP belongs to the correct VLAN subnet

▶ Performance issues → Review NSS hardware acceleration status
